Description
LED SURFACE LIGHTING DEVICE USING EDGE-ILLUMINATED LIGHT-GUIDE PLATE
The present invention refers to a lightning device, comprising a plurality of light emitting diodes as light sources.
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
The light produced by light emitting diodes (LEDs) is characterised, at a perception level, by an intense light concentrated in a very small point. In fact, as this technology advances, this relation tends to increase (more intensity and a smaller emitting point). This feature involves that its use must be followed by accessory elements to protect the direct perception of the emitting source.
The means usually used to mitigate these uncomfortable effects to the direct vision is the interposition of light diffuser materials between the LED and the observer, or simply placing the lighting apparatuses so that they cannot be observed directly, such as e.g. at the ceiling.
From a functional point of view, we can divide the lightning produced by LEDs into two great groups. The first group is that formed by LEDs that produce light not "lightning", i.e. they are only lightened themselves. This feature make then specially useful for signalling applications, to the point that nowadays their application for this end covers all the scopes of our usual life in a lot of apparatuses.
The second group are the LEDs whose features of power and configuration permit to lighten with a greater or lower intensity, but, as stated previously, some measures must be taken in their application to prevent undesired effects.
Some of the most common systems to prevent these undesired effects and their consequences are the following ones : interposition of a translucent diffuser screen, that has the drawback that it decreases the light efficiency and the point of the LEDs can be seen;
- interposition of a prismatic screen of diffusion effects, that presents a good light efficiency, but it is not suitable for direct vision; - lightning by reflection of the light of the
LEDs on an opaque screen, that decreases very considerably the lightning performance;
- parabolic cone around the emitter LED, that has a efficient lightning, but it is not suitable for direct vision;
- increase of the number of low power emitting LEDs in the place of few of high power, which increases substantially the emitting surface.
D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ION
With the lightning device of the invention said drawbacks can be solved, presenting other advantages that will be described. The lightning device of the present invention comprises a plurality of light emitting diodes as light source, and it is characterised in that it comprises a transparent plate that is lightened by said light emitting diodes, said plate defining a frontal face and a rear face, and four small faces, two lateral faces, an upper face and a lower face, and it that the rear face and three of said small faces are coated with an opaque material that reflects the light, said light emitting diodes being placed in front of the small face free of said opaque material that reflects the light.
Preferably, said light emitting diodes are of different colours, red, green and blue alternated to each other. Therefore, the device of the present invention emits light of any colour, combining these basic colours. Advantageously, said light emitting diodes are placed aligned in front of one of the side faces of the transparent plate.
Furthermore, the frontal face of said transparent plate can comprise a margin also coated with an opaque material that reflects the light, said margin being wider than the side of said frontal face adjacent to the side face in front of which said light emitting diodes are placed.
According to a preferred embodiment, said opaque material that reflects the light is white paint and said transparent plate is made from methacrylate .
The objective of the lightning device of the present invention is to find a cold lightning system by LEDs that produces enough intensity, balanced, and with an optimal direct perception of the emitter source.
Thanks to the device of the present invention it is possible to obtain lighting apparatuses that do not produce heat, comfortable for the direct perception at a short distance (20 cm) and with an acceptable light performance.
Therefore, the advantages that the present invention presents are the following: it is obtained a uniform diffusion of the light not being observed the emitting LEDs; - it is obtained a compact, modular and versatile system; and its lighting quality is acceptable in a distance up to about 2 meters.

DESCRIPTION OF A PREFERRED EMBODIMENT
As it can be seen from Fig. 1, the lighting device of the present invention is formed by a transparent plate, designated generally by reference numeral 1, which is lightened by a plurality of light emitting diodes or
LEDs 2.
Said transparent plate 1 is preferably made from methacrylate and is coated by an opaque material that reflects the light except at its frontal face 3 and at one of its side faces 4. Said opaque material that reflects the light is preferably white paint.
Said LEDs 2 are placed aligned and they are of different colours, particularly they are red, green and blue, and they are alternated to each other, so that it is possible to lighten with any desired colour from these primary colours.
The frontal face 3 also comprises opaque material that reflects the light, forming a margin 5, that is wider than the side placed adjacent to the side face 4 lightened by said LEDs 2.
If whished, the lightning device of the present invention can be modular, i.e. several transparent plates 1 can be joined to each other, forming a single device.
As a non-limitative example the dimensions of said transparent plate 1 are reported.
Said dimensions are:
- Height: 660 mm.
- Width: 95 mm.
- Thickness: 8 mm. - Maximum width of the margin of the frontal face: 18 mm.
It is apparent that the dimensions of said transparent plate 1 can be any if the desired lightning level is obtained. As stated previously, with the device of the present invention a desired lightning is obtained in about
2 meters, and the user does not see the light points.
Furthermore, the device of the present invention is extremely light, and can be adapted easily to another elements. E.g. it is a device suitable for applications in wall lights, modular panels, ceiling roses, chrome therapy and architectural lightning.
Even though reference is made to a specific embodiment of the invention, it is apparent for a person skilled in the art that the described lighting device is susceptible of numerous variations and modifications, and that all the details cited can be substituted by other technically equivalent ones, without departing from the scope of protection defined by the attached claims.
